Description

Interleukin-18 (IL-18) is a cytokine that belongs to the IL-1 superfamily and is produced by macrophages and other cells. IL-18 works by binding to the interleukin-18 receptor, and together with IL-12 it induces cell-mediated immunity following infection with microbial products like lipopolysaccharide (LPS). After stimulation with IL-18, natural killer (NK) cells and certain T cells release another important cytokine called interferon-γ (IFNγ) or type II interferon that plays an important role in activating the macrophages or other cells.

This aptamer was selected by scientists at Base Pair Biotechnologies using proprietary methods and human Interleukin-18. [Novus Biologicals, Cat #NBC1-20152]

Target:   IL-18 (Interleukin-18)

Target Species:   human

Target Type:   protein

Affinity Constant (Kd):   20.4 nM

Notes

Please note that aptamers have much lower molecular weights than antibodies. Thus, there are typically five to fifteen times as many moles or molecules of aptamers present in a solution containing an equal mass. For example, 100 micrograms of an aptamer is equivalent to 0.5 to 1.5 mg of antibody, depending on the particular aptamer.
